我使用的是无限Ajax滚动插件(http://infiniteajaxscroll.com/),它对我来说工作得非常好,除了一件事。
默认情况下,插件会隐藏所有分页链接(由服务器生成),并在容器的顶部(通过历史插件)和底部(通过触发器插件)显示load more items链接。
我可以覆盖Trigger扩展上的链接(文本和类),但History扩展使用相同的值,因此您将在容器的上方和下方看到相同的按钮。
我尝试向History扩展添加相同的参数,但它不起作用:
var ias = $.ias({
container: ".js-job-container",
item: ".item--job ",
pagination: ".pagination",
next: ".pagination-direction-tab-next",
delay: 0
});
ias.extension(new IASTriggerExtension({ text: "View more", html: '<a class="button button--view-more button--action">{text}</a>' }));
ias.extension(new IASSpinnerExtension());
ias.extension(new IASPagingExtension());
ias.extension(new IASHistoryExtension({ text:'Previous elements', html: '<a class="button button--view-more button--action">{text}</a>', prev: '.pagination-direction-tab-prev'}));有没有我遗漏的覆盖默认文本和类的选项?
干杯,格萨
发布于 2014-07-06 18:53:39
此功能在v2.1.2中添加。
请参见textPrev和htmlPrev选项。
https://stackoverflow.com/questions/24207075
复制相似问题